The Most Powerful Production Rolls-Royce Yet

image
Listen to this storyAuto
0:000:00

Rolls-Royce has officially introduced the Spectre Black Badge in India at a staggering ₹9.50 crore (ex-showroom), making it the most expensive and most powerful all-electric vehicle from the iconic British marque. This launch follows its global unveiling in February 2025 and marks the arrival of the first-ever Black Badge treatment on a fully electric Rolls-Royce.

Powertrain and Performance

The Spectre Black Badge is equipped with dual electric motors, one on each axle, generating a combined output of 650 bhp and 1,075 Nm of torque. This makes it the most potent series-production vehicle ever made by Rolls-Royce. The 0–100 km/h sprint is dispatched in just 4.1 seconds, an astonishing figure for a car of its size and luxury stature.

In keeping with the brand’s philosophy of “effortless performance”, the EV features multiple drive modes, including a new ‘Infinity Mode’ that unlocks the full performance potential. A bespoke launch control system, dubbed ‘Spirited Mode’, has also been integrated, enhancing acceleration capabilities.

Battery and Range

At its core lies a 102 kWh battery pack, offering an impressive WLTP-claimed range of 493–530 km on a full charge. This ensures that the Spectre Black Badge delivers not only power but also long-distance touring capability befitting the Rolls-Royce name.

Chassis Enhancements 

Rolls-Royce has made a series of mechanical revisions to further distinguish the Black Badge variant from the standard Spectre. These include:

  • Increased steering weight
  • Enhanced roll stabilization
  • Stiffened dampers for improved high-speed composure

Together, these changes ensure a more engaging and controlled driving experience, tailored for those who seek more than just serene luxury.

The Black Badge Design

True to the Black Badge identity, the Spectre receives an extensive aesthetic transformation. Key design changes include:

  • Darkened Pantheon grille
  • Blackened Spirit of Ecstasy and Rolls-Royce badging
  • Smoked chrome on door handles, window surrounds, and bumper accents

The model also features 23-inch five-spoke forged aluminium wheels, available in part-polished or all-black finishes. A customisable backplate behind the grille allows owners to add a personalised splash of colour, adding to the Spectre’s already bespoke ethos.

Cabin Upgrades

Inside, the Spectre Black Badge continues to redefine automotive opulence. One of the standout features is the illuminated fascia, which now incorporates the infinity symbol, a hallmark of all Black Badge Rolls-Royces. The star-studded panel includes 5,500 individual 'stars' set in a piano black backdrop, creating a celestial motif that is both futuristic and elegant.

Drivers can also personalise the digital instrument cluster with five different colour themes, adding another layer of customisation to the cockpit experience. At the heart of the vehicle's tech suite is ‘Spirit’, Rolls-Royce’s all-new digital operating system, offering seamless connectivity and intuitive control.
